Myth: Dental Surgery Is Always Unpleasant



You may believe that oral surgery always entails discomfort, however that's just not true. As opposed to common belief, dental surgery treatments aren't always excruciating experiences. Thanks to developments in anesthetic and sedation strategies, dental doctors have the ability to make sure that individuals fit and pain-free throughout the whole treatment.

Prior to the surgical procedure starts, you'll be provided anesthetic, which numbs the location being treated and prevents you from really feeling any kind of discomfort. Furthermore, if you experience any kind of anxiety or concern, your oral specialist can administer sedation to aid you kick back and feel even more comfortable.

Whether you're obtaining a tooth extraction, dental implant, or jaw surgery, felt confident that dental surgery can be a pain-free and comfortable experience.

Myth: Oral Surgery Is Just for Emergency situations



In contrast to common belief, dental surgery isn't restricted to emergency situations.

While it holds true that oral surgery can be needed in cases of serious injury or sudden pain, it's additionally commonly utilized for intended treatments that boost the total wellness and feature of your mouth.

Myth: Recuperation From Dental Surgery Takes a Long Period Of Time



If you have actually gone through oral surgery, you may be stunned to find out that the misconception regarding healing taking a long time isn't necessarily true. While it's true that some oral surgeries may require a longer recovery period, such as intricate treatments like jaw realignment or multiple removals, lots of routine oral surgeries have a fairly quick recuperation time.

For example, procedures such as wisdom tooth extraction or dental implant placement typically have a much shorter recovery time, normally varying from a couple of days to a couple of weeks. Factors such as your total wellness, the complexity of the surgery, and exactly how well you adhere to post-operative directions can also influence the size of your healing.

It is very important to consult with your oral surgeon to obtain a precise quote of your particular healing time.

Myth: Dental Surgery Is Not Needed forever Oral Wellness



Dental surgery plays a crucial function in keeping good oral wellness. Contrary to the preferred misconception, it isn't simply a cosmetic procedure or an unneeded high-end. Right here's why oral surgery is needed for your dental wellness:

- Extraction of influenced wisdom teeth: Getting rid of impacted wisdom teeth prevents overcrowding, infection, and prospective damage to adjacent teeth.

- Therapy of oral infections: Dental surgery can assist treat serious gum infections, abscesses, and various other oral infections that can result in serious wellness problems if left without treatment.

- Restorative jaw surgical procedure: Jaw misalignment can cause problem in consuming, speech problems, and can also lead to temporomandibular joint (TMJ) disorder. Dental surgery can fix these problems.

- Oral implants: Dental surgery is required for putting oral implants, which are the best remedy for changing missing teeth.

- Therapy of dental cancer: Oral surgery is frequently essential for the elimination of malignant lumps and the restoration of cells influenced by oral cancer cells.

Don't fall for the myth that oral surgery is unneeded. It's a vital part of keeping good dental health and protecting against additional issues.
